Software Developer

4 days ago


Boston, Massachusetts, United States Snyk Full time
About Snyk

Snyk is a developer security platform that empowers development teams to find, prioritize, and fix security vulnerabilities in code, dependencies, containers, and cloud infrastructure. Our mission is to make the world a more secure place by enabling developers to develop fast and stay secure.

Job Description

We are seeking a highly skilled Software Engineer to join our Developer Experience team. As a Software Engineer at Snyk, you will be at the forefront of building the future of application security. You will be challenged to create high-performance, reliable, and scalable services while collaborating closely with cross-functional teams.

Key Responsibilities:

  • Analyze, design, and implement high-quality solutions to problems with well-tested, maintainable code.
  • Build systems with the long-term in mind, focusing on good design, robust testing, and sustainability from the perspective of cost and scale.
  • Support our customers by resolving bugs and customer support escalations.
  • Communicate thoughtfully, kindly, and clearly, both verbally and in the written form.
  • Owning decisions throughout the technical process while working directly with other teams or functions across technical and non-technical domains.
  • Play an active part in a Snyk engineering team by working collaboratively with others.

Requirements:

  • At least 2 years of commercial experience as a Software Engineer.
  • Experience in software systems design, and familiarity with fundamental computer science concepts (algorithms, complexity, data structures).
  • Proficiency in at least one of our core programming languages (Go, TypeScript), and a willingness and enthusiasm for learning new languages and technologies.
  • Experience in at least one of:
    • Building highly reliable, scalable microservice back-ends for web APIs or applications, or other types of large-scale, high reliability systems.
    • Building web UIs, CLIs or APIs for use by other engineers.
    • Building infrastructure or platform automation, or observability or release tools.
  • Demonstrable skill in effective software testing.
  • Strong commitment to code quality, and the value of giving and receiving feedback through code reviews.
  • Ability to deal with ambiguity, and respond with agility when requirements and priorities change.
  • Effective communicator both verbally and in writing.

We are looking for individuals who are passionate about crafting exceptional software and solving complex problems. If you are a motivated and detail-oriented Software Engineer who is eager to contribute to a dynamic team, we encourage you to apply.

We care deeply about the warm, inclusive environment we've created and we value diversity – we welcome applications from those typically underrepresented in tech.

About Our Benefits

We offer a comprehensive benefits package that includes flexible working hours, work-from-home allowances, in-office perks, and time off for learning and self-development. Our benefits also include generous vacation and wellness time off, country-specific holidays, and 100% paid parental leave for all caregivers. We prioritize health, wellness, financial security, and life balance with programs tailored to your location and role.



  • Boston, Massachusetts, United States CRITICAL Software Full time

    Unlock Your Potential as a Principal Engineer at Critical SoftwareWe are seeking an experienced Principal Engineer to join our team in the North American market. As a key member of our engineering team, you will play a crucial role in driving our growth and success.Key Responsibilities:Support business development by identifying and generating leads through...

  • Software Developer

    4 days ago


    Boston, Massachusetts, United States Entegee Full time

    Job Title: Software EngineerEntegee is seeking a sk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for developing and maintaining software applications with a focus on user interface development and embedded systems.Key Responsibilities:Design and develop software applications using C++, JavaScript, and Python.Work...

  • Software Developer

    1 week ago


    Boston, Massachusetts, United States Entegee Full time

    Job Title: Software EngineerJob Summary:We are seeking a highly skilled Software Engineer to join our team at Entegee. As a Software Engineer, you will be responsible for developing and maintaining software applications with a focus on user interface development and embedded systems.Key Responsibilities:Design and develop software applications using C++,...

  • Software Developer

    1 month ago


    Boston, Massachusetts, United States Snyk Full time

    About SnykSnyk is a leading developer security platform that empowers development teams to build secure software from the start. Our mission is to make the digital world a safer place by providing innovative solutions to complex security challenges.Job SummaryWe are seeking a highly skilled Software Engineer to join our Developer Experience team. As a key...

  • Software Developer

    2 weeks ago


    Boston, Massachusetts, United States Escher Group Full time

    Job Title: Software EngineerAt Escher Group, we are seeking a highly skilled Software Engineer to join our team. As a Software Engineer, you will be responsible for developing and extending business applications for our clients using the Agile Scrum methodology.Key Responsibilities:Develop and extend features for Escher clients on the Escher core...

  • Software Developer

    2 weeks ago


    Boston, Massachusetts, United States Snyk Full time

    About SnykSnyk is a developer security platform that empowers development teams to find, prioritize, and fix security vulnerabilities in code, dependencies, containers, and cloud infrastructure. Our mission is to make the world a more secure place by enabling developers to develop fast and stay secure.Job DescriptionWe are seeking a highly skilled Software...


  • Boston, Massachusetts, United States Dynamo Software Full time

    Role OverviewWe are seeking a highly motivated and results-driven Business Development Representative to join our team at Dynamo Software. As a key member of our sales team, you will be responsible for generating new business opportunities and driving revenue growth through strategic outreach and relationship-building.Key ResponsibilitiesEstablish and...

  • Software Developer

    11 hours ago


    Boston, Massachusetts, United States INFICON Full time

    Job Title: Software DeveloperINFICON is a leading provider of innovative instrumentation, critical sensor technologies, and Smart Manufacturing/Industry 4.0 software solutions. We are seeking a skilled Software Developer to join our Intelligent Manufacturing Systems (IMS) division.Responsibilities:Design, develop, implement, and maintain world-class...

  • Software Developer

    4 weeks ago


    Boston, Massachusetts, United States The Ceres Group Full time

    Job Title: Software EngineerJob Function: Software EngineerIndustry: Asset ManagementJob Summary:We are seeking a skilled Software Engineer to join our team at The Ceres Group. As a key member of our investment and applications development teams, you will play a critical role in the development of middle-tier components and Excel applications for our core...


  • Boston, Massachusetts, United States Dynamo Software Full time

    Job OverviewDynamo Software is a leading global FinTech Research and Portfolio Management SaaS provider offering an industry-tailored, highly configurable SaaS platform solving challenges across the alternative investment landscape.We seek an energetic and passionate sales-oriented individual who will tenaciously contact and generate prospects for our...

  • Software Developer

    4 weeks ago


    Boston, Massachusetts, United States Harnham Full time

    About the Opportunity:We are seeking a highly skilled Senior Software Engineer to join our team at Harnham. This is a fully remote role, ideal for someone based in or around the Greater Boston area, with the potential for indefinite extensions.Key Responsibilities:Develop and maintain software solutions within a 3D robotics simulation environment.Work on...


  • Boston, Massachusetts, United States Sevita Full time

    Job SummaryWe are seeking a highly skilled Software Development Specialist to join our team. As a key member of our software development team, you will be responsible for designing, developing, and maintaining software applications to meet the needs of our clients.Key ResponsibilitiesDevelop and maintain software applications using a variety of programming...


  • Boston, Massachusetts, United States United Software Group Full time

    Immediate.NET Developer OpportunityWe are seeking a highly skilled.NET Developer to join our team at our Boston office. As a key member of our development team, you will be responsible for designing and implementing robust.NET Web API web services.Key Responsibilities:Design and develop.NET Web API web servicesCollaborate with cross-functional teams to...


  • Boston, Massachusetts, United States IntePros Full time

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at IntePros in Boston, MA. As a key member of our team, you will be responsible for leading the development of embedded software for our Robotic Assisted Surgery platform.Job Summary:This is a 1-year W2 contract assignment with the option of being...


  • Boston, Massachusetts, United States Jobot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Developer to join our dynamic technology team. As a key member of our team, you will be responsible for designing, developing, and implementing high-quality software solutions using PHP, TypeScript, and NodeJS.Key ResponsibilitiesDesign and develop software solutions that meet the...


  • Boston, Massachusetts, United States IntePros Full time

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at IntePros in Boston, MA. As a key member of our team, you will be responsible for leading the development of embedded software for our Robotic Assisted Surgery platform.Job Summary:This is a 1-year W2 contract assignment with the option of being...


  • Boston, Massachusetts, United States QuEra Computing Inc. Full time

    Job Title: Software Development ManagerQuEra Computing Inc. is seeking a highly skilled Software Development Manager to lead the Cloud Access Software Team responsible for developing the software stack that provides cloud access to QuEra's quantum computers.Key Responsibilities:Lead, mentor, and coordinate the engineering team responsible for building and...


  • Boston, Massachusetts, United States IntePros Full time

    Embedded Software Engineer Job DescriptionWe are seeking an experienced Embedded Software Engineer to join our team at IntePros in Boston, MA. As a key contributor to our Robotic Assisted Surgery platform, you will be responsible for leading the development of embedded software, collaborating with cross-functional teams, and mentoring junior team members.Key...


  • Boston, Massachusetts, United States KForce Full time

    Job DescriptionJob Title: Principal Software Engineer (Quant, Fintech)Job Summary:Our client, a leading financial services company, is seeking a highly skilled Principal Software Engineer (Quant, Fintech) to join their team in Boston, Massachusetts. As a key member of the team, you will be responsible for designing, developing, and implementing sophisticated...


  • Boston, Massachusetts, United States IntePros Full time

    Job Title: Embedded Software EngineerWe are seeking an experienced Embedded Software Engineer to join our team at IntePros in Boston, MA. As a key member of our team, you will be responsible for leading the development of embedded software for our Robotic Assisted Surgery platform.Job Responsibilities:Participate in scrum activities and may act as scrum...